Keeping good drivers that you can trust and rely on. Also, finding guys that will take care of the business at hand and are professional. It’s important to let the drivers know that they are the greatest asset that a trucking company has.
Take your time and be smart with the loads that you take. Focus on the end of the week gross rate and learn from hands-on experience. In time you will learn that it’s not how many miles you run, it’s the quality of freight you pull.
